Output dbf5c51a8938e966f1b240d915e121514473dd23dc9d77441630bb08e710a32f:29

value
636532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c07273cc92dad90e924ddf4765e0094cc048d14 OP_EQUAL
address
38d1r988T6NkD1oTv2mP3bYcVwJsd1DmDH
transaction
dbf5c51a8938e966f1b240d915e121514473dd23dc9d77441630bb08e710a32f
confirmations
133904
spent
true